Output 708c7fe5bd30fb6c732f763f28172924fa1382b9572125417ec1891b329b6b1a:1

value
4636900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c643c3d751fa21e0981e970971a00d8967cac3b2 OP_EQUAL
address
3KmLtvPEHShzVDL7yoXyum2KPpigL7HNc5
transaction
708c7fe5bd30fb6c732f763f28172924fa1382b9572125417ec1891b329b6b1a
confirmations
503742
spent
true